As a Substation Engineering Intern, you will be supporting the work of designing the physical layout and electrical systems of projects on high-voltage substations at voltages from 12kV to 500kV with the goal of providing excellent quality work for our clients.

This is a full-time, 10-week internship that begins in early June 2025.  Work may be done remotely from any U.S. location, or hybrid from our Reston, VA office.   At this time, we are unable to provide relocation nor housing assistance for this internship.

As a Substation Physical Engineering Intern, you will:

  • Assist engineers and designers in the physical and electrical design of substation upgrade projects

  • Review and update substation layout drawings including One-Line Diagrams, Electrical Arrangements and Sections, Grounding Plans, Conduit Plans, Lightning Protection Plans, Control Cubicle Arrangements, and Low-Voltage AC/DC Wiring Diagrams

  • Perform AC Systems Calculations and Design

  • Development of Equipment Specification and Selection based on Clients Criteria

  • Development of Bill of Materials based on Design Criteria
